Think about how many cover bands there are in your city, or in your state; possibly hundreds or more. Every cover band is contacting the same bars and venues you are asking for gigs. What gives you the competitive advantage? We have found that without fail – venues and bars will book a cover band that DRAWS fans and has a solid fan base. Period. Good music is important of course, but if your cover band draws 0 fans and another cover band in your city draws 50+ fans but are “not as good” as you are musically, the venue or bar will almost without fail hire the cover band that draws more fans to their shows.
